MSI brings Windows 7 touchscreen PC

Microsoft International has just launched its multi-faceted touchscreen PC which is crafted to run on windows 7. This new touchscreen PC named as AE2010 can be attached to your bedroom wall.

The Wind Top AE2010 is manufactured with a 20inch screen, 1600 x 900 display and an AMD Athlon X2 3250 dual-core processor. Early deliveries will come up with Windows Vista Home Premium pre-installed accompanied with a free Windows 7 upgrade coupon inside the package.

Graphics are handled by an AMD ATI Raedon HD 3200 card carrying 128MB of DDR 3 memory, while the machine itself brags 4GB of 533MHz DDR2 RAM. A 320GB hard drive is inbuilt into the computer.

On one side of the new PC you will find an optical disc drive which is accomplished with dual-core DVD burning. A four-in-one memory card reader and six USB ports are placed at the same side.
If you hang the AE2020 onto your bedroom wall using the PC’s innate supports it can become wireless window onto the web due to integrated support for 802.11n Wi-Fi. A 1.3Mp webcam is an ingrained feature into the PC’s body.

The Wind Top AE2010 price starts at around $650 and is already in the market, but the price for UK customer is not yet declared.
